THE SAFETY AND EFFECTIVENESS OF THE HYDRUS AQUEOUS IMPLANT FOR LOWERING INTRAOCULAR PRESSURE IN GLAUCOMA PATIENTS UNDERGOING CATARACT SURGERY, A PROSPECTIVE,MULTICENTER, RANDOMIZED, CONTROLLED CLINICAL TRIAL - Hydrus 4 study

入选标准
- •INCLUSION CRITERIA:
- •Subjects must meet the following inclusion criteria to be eligible for the study eye
- •* Male and female patients, at least 45 years of age
- •* An operable age-related cataract with BCVA of 20/40 or worse, eligible for phacoemulsification; if BCVA is better than 20/40, testing with a BAT meter on a medium setting must result in BCVA 20/40 or worse
- •* A diagnosis of POAG treated with 1 to 4 hypotensive medications
- •* Optic nerve appearance characteristic of glaucoma
- •* Medicated IOP <= 31 mmHg
- •* Diurnal IOP >= 22 mmHg and <= 34 mmHg after wash out of ocular hypotensive medications
- •* IOP increase >= 3 mmHg after wash out of ocular hypotensive medications
- •* Visual field examination using Humphrey 24-2 SITA standard, meeting protocol specified minimum criteria for glaucoma defined as:
- •- Mild: visual field loss on Humphrey visual field testing, with mean deviation (MD) between 0 and -6dB; fewer than 25% of points depressed below the 5% level and fewer than 15% of points depressed below the 1% level on pattern deviation plot; and no point within central 5° with sensitivity <15dB
- •- Moderate: visual field loss on Humphrey visual field testing, with mean deviation worse than -6dB but no worse than -12dB; fewer than 50% of points depressed below the 5% level, and fewer than 25% of points depressed below the 1% level on pattern deviation plot; no points within central 5° with sensitivity of <=0dB; and only one hemifield containing a point with sensitivity <15dB within
- •5° of fixation
- •* In subjects where the VF exam is not confirmatory for glaucomatous defect, retinal nerve fiber layer optical scanning laser imaging supporting ophthalmoscopy findings shall be performed
- •* Shaffer grade >= III in all four quadrants
- •* Cup:disc (c:d) ratio <= 0.8
- •* Absence of peripheral anterior synechiae (PAS), rubeosis or other angle abnormalities that could impair placement of the implant
- •* Subject is able and willing to attend scheduled follow-up exams for 2 years postoperatively (and up to 5 years postoperatively as part of a post-approval study)
- •* Subject understands and signs the informed consent;INTRAOPERATIVE 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A
- •Individuals who meet the following intraoperative eligibility criteria in the study eye will be randomized into the treatment or control arms of this study.;Subjects must have:
- •* An intact and centered capsulorrhexis
- •* An intact posterior capsular bag
- •* A well-centered monofocal IOL placed in the capsular bag
- •* A clear view of an open angle and visualization of the angle with direct gonioscopy
- •following intracameral instillation of a miotic agent, and;Subjects must not have:
- •* Evidence of zonular dehiscence/rupture
- •* Intraoperative floppy iris syndrome
排除标准
- •EXCLUSION CRITERIA
- •Excluded from the study will be individuals with the following characteristics. Unless specified otherwise, all ocular criteria refer to the study eye only.
- •* Closed angle forms of glaucoma
- •* Congenital or developmental glaucoma
- •* Secondary glaucoma (such as neovascular, uveitic, pseudoexfoliative, pigmentary, lensinduced,
- •steroid-induced, trauma induced, or glaucoma associated with increased episcleral venous pressure)
- •* Use of more than 4 ocular hypotensive medications (combination medications count as two medications)
- •* Previous argon laser trabeculoplasty, trabeculectomy, tube shunts, or any other prior filtration or cilioablative surgery
- •* Prior surgery for an ab-interno or ab-externo device implanted in or through the Schlemm*s Canal
- •* Inability to complete a reliable 24-2 SITA Standard Humphrey visual field on the study eye at screening (fixation losses, false positive errors and false negative errors should not be greater than 33%)
- •* Use of oral hypotensive medication for glaucoma for treatment of the fellow eye
- •* Subjects with advanced glaucoma or any subject who presents with an unacceptable risk to the subject of a washout of ocular hypotensive medications
- •* Best corrected visual acuity worse than 20/80 in the fellow eye
- •* A 24-2 SITA Standard Humphrey visual field mean deviation (MD) of worse than -12dB in the fellow eye
- •* Central corneal thickness > 620 microns and < 480 microns
- •* Proliferative diabetic retinopathy
- •* Previous surgery for retinal detachment
- •* Previous corneal surgery or clinically significant corneal dystrophy, e.g., Fuch*s dystrophy (>12 confluent guttae)
- •* Unclear ocular media preventing visualization of the fundus or anterior chamber angle
- •* Degenerative visual disorders such as wet age-related macular degeneration
- •* Clinically significant ocular pathology, other than cataract and glaucoma
- •* Clinically significant ocular inflammation or infection within 6 months prior to screening
- •* Presence of extensive iris processes that obscure visualization of the trabecular meshwork
- •* Unable to discontinue use of blood thinners in accordance with surgeon*s standard postoperative instructions
- •* Known or suspected elevated episcleral venous pressure due to Sturge Weber, nanophthalmos, orbital congestive disease
- •* Uncontrolled systemic disease that in the opinion of the Investigator would put the subject*s health at risk and/or prevent the subject from completing all study visits
- •* Current participation or participation in another investigational drug or device clinical trial (which includes the fellow eye) within the past 30 calendar days
- •* Pregnant or nursing women; or women of child bearing age not using medically acceptable contraceptives
